Stellantis attacks Tesla with its new ultra-fast battery

Taking the electric car market to a new level, Stellantis is poised to make its mark with its next-generation battery technology. Developed in collaboration with American startup Factorial Energy, the solid-state batteries, which can charge from 15% to 90% in just 18 minutes, are targeted for integration into pilot fleets as early as 2026.

More range, less weight

Behind this ambitious goal lies a solid-electrolyte battery technology called FEST (Factorial Electrolyte System Technology). These batteries achieve an impressive energy density of 375 Wh/kg compared to current lithium-ion batteries, potentially offering significantly longer ranges without increasing vehicle weight. For comparison, current LFP batteries are around 175 Wh/kg, while NMC batteries are around 250 Wh/kg.

Furthermore, it promises to experience no performance loss from freezing temperatures of -30°C to extreme temperatures of +45°C, eliminating range anxiety in winter and the fear of overheating in summer.

The goal is to undermine the leader

Stellantis's move poses a direct challenge to Tesla, the market leader in ultra-fast charging. By setting a concrete date, the European manufacturer aims to break away from the often delayed promises of its competitors and gain a market advantage. The 2026 pilot target is a considerably more aggressive timeline than the 2028 and later dates outlined by brands like Hyundai and Toyota.

But victory isn't yet assured for Stellantis. Chinese giants CATL and BYD are working on batteries that promise a five-minute charge, while Toyota and Hyundai are solidifying their market positions with record-breaking range targets. Stellantis faces two major challenges: proving this impressive lab-based performance in real-world conditions and enabling large-scale mass production without exploding costs.
